I'm sorry to hear that things didn't go well for you, but it sounds like they are looking into this. Please remember that it is a holiday weekend (weekends are normally bad as it is.) Also, sending in several petitions does not get a faster response. It just fills the queue and slows everything down because the GMs have to look at every one of the petitions even though a GM is already working on it. This may not seem like much, but say the 5 teams before you all sent in 5 petitions, they would have to deal with 25 petitions before they could even get to yours. That is a lot of wasted time when they really only had 5 problems.
We as players can help the speed of the GMs by not swamping them with unnecessary petitions.
One last thing, a bug report will not get you a fast response from the GMs. It's viewed as a "Hey, I found this bug. You should look at it when you have time" kind of thing. Bug reports do help track down problems because it can show a pattern in what causes it. -

The main problem with this is that there are just not very many PvPers in the game anymore. Open PvP is an idea that comes up all the time and it gets shot down over and over again. Adding more PvP zones will just spread out the PvPers and do nothing to get more people to try it. 90% of the player base (no one knows for sure but most figure the PvP population is under 10%) doesn't want to PvP. The entire PvP system was redone to try and get more people in the PvP zones. It didn't work. All that happened was we lost more of the PvP population because the new system was broken in different ways.
At this point in the games life, it's just not worth the cost to try and rebuild PvP again. -
